On the day at any TEF centre

  • Bring the same photo ID you registered with — usually a passport, permanent resident card, or another government-issued ID the centre accepted at booking.
  • Arrive early. Centres routinely refuse entry once a session has started, and the fee is not refunded.
  • Phones, watches and bags go into storage before you enter the room.
  • Results are typically emailed one to four weeks after the sitting, depending on the centre.
  • A TEF result is valid for two years from the date you sat it.

Which TEF Canada centre should I choose?

Any accredited centre produces the same, equally valid result, so choose on practicality: how soon a seat is free, how far you have to travel, and whether the centre offers the exact version of the test you need. Big-city centres run more sittings but sell out faster; smaller regional centres often have space when Montréal and Toronto do not.

Can I register for the TEF at the test centre in person?

Rarely. Most Canadian centres take registrations online only and explicitly say they cannot book you in by phone or at reception. Use the booking link on the centre page, or the centre’s own registration page where it has one.

What is the difference between TEF Canada and TEFAQ?

TEF Canada is the four-skill version accepted by IRCC for permanent residence and citizenship. TEFAQ (also written TEF Québec) is used for Québec immigration programs and is commonly taken as speaking and listening only. Most Canadian centres are accredited for both, but you book them as separate exams.
